Was elected in 1816 by 183 to 34 electoral votes over Rufus King. Reelected
in 1820 by 231 to 1 electoral votes over John Quincy Adams, his successor.
During both terms Daniel D. Tompkins served as vice-president. Was the first
president to take the oath on a raised portico in front of the Capitol. The
dissenter in the 1820 election thought only George Washington deserved to be
unanimously elected. Was the third president to die on the Fourth of July.

Spence Monroe, Sr - Elizabeth Eliza Jones

Spence Monroe, Sr was born at VA 1727. His parents were Andrew Monroe and Christian Tyler.

He married Elizabeth Eliza Jones . Elizabeth Eliza Jones was born at VA 1721 .

They were the parents of 5 children:
James Lawrence Monroe, 5th President of the Usa born 24 Apr 1758.
Andrew Monroe
Elizabeth Monroe born 1754.
Spence Monroe born 1759.
Joseph Jones Monroe born 1764.

Spence Monroe, Sr died 1774 at Westmoreland County, Virginia .
